Senate Resolution No. 734
BY: Senator KAPLAN
HONORING Firefighter Fred Bencivenga upon the
occasion of his designation for special recognition
after 50 years of dedicated service to the New Hyde
Park Fire Department on April 6, 2019
WHEREAS, Citizens across our State and Nation are inspired by and
indebted to our noble volunteer firefighters who exhibit courage and
bravery every day in the course of their duties; and
WHEREAS, Volunteer firefighters exemplify the power of human
compassion and the strength of the American spirit through actions of
the most heroic magnitude; their sacrifices and their selfless
dedication merit tribute and recognition by all citizens of this great
country; and
WHEREAS, This Legislative Body is justly proud to honor Firefighter
Fred Bencivenga upon the occasion of his designation for special
recognition after 50 years of dedicated service to the New Hyde Park
Fire Department to be celebrated at its Annual Inspection Dinner on
Saturday, April 6, 2019, at The Jericho Terrace, Mineola, New York; and
WHEREAS, Fred Bencivenga joined the New Hyde Park Fire Department on
September 2, 1969; and
WHEREAS, An active member of the Enterprise Company No. 1, Fred
Bencivenga served the Department on the 75th and 100th Anniversary
Committees, and as a member of the Termites Drill Team and New York
State Drill Team Captain's Association; and
